The Role

This is a hands-on PT position working with patients who need help recovering from orthopedic injuries, surgery, pain, and movement restrictions.

You'll see patients through different stages of recovery. Some may be starting therapy after surgery, while others may be ready to work on higher-level strength, balance, or return-to-activity goals.

You'll be responsible for evaluating the patient, deciding what treatment is appropriate, and updating the plan as their needs change.
